Linux에서 원격으로 Windows 8.1에서 프로세스를 시작하는 방법

Linux에서 원격으로 Windows 8.1에서 프로세스를 시작하는 방법

winexe를 사용해 보았습니다. Windows XP 및 Windows 7에서는 제대로 작동했지만 Windows 8.1에서는 작동하지 않습니다. 내가 얻는 건

ERROR: Cannot open control pipe - NT_STATUS_INVALID_PARAMETER

이전 버전의 Windows에서는 동일한 명령이 제대로 실행됩니다. 제가 아는 바로는 Windows 8.1에서 winexe에서 사용하는 SMB 1.0에 대한 지원이 중단되었기 때문입니다. winexe가 SMB 2를 사용하도록 강제하는 방법이 있습니까?

아니면 Windows 8.1에서 작동하는 다른 도구가 있을까요?

나는 와인에서 PsExec(SMB2, 즉 Windows 8.1을 지원함)을 시도했지만 제대로 작동하지 못했습니다.

답변1

Windows에서 Powershell을 실행하는 데 필요한 cron 탭 작업이 있습니다. 내장된 Windows 구성요소로는 이 작업을 수행하기가 어렵습니다(불가능하지는 않습니까?).

나는 사용하기로 결정했다.파워셸 서버하지만 모든 Windows SSH 서버 소프트웨어는 작동해야 합니다.

답변2

winexe를 사용하여 winexe를 살펴보세요.

페이지에는 GNU/Linux(및 Samba 4 소프트웨어 패키지를 구축할 수 있는 다른 Unices에서도 가능)의 Windows NT/2000/XP/2003 시스템에서 명령을 실행할 수 있다고 나와 있습니다.

또한 Windows 방화벽을 올바르게 구성한 후에는 Windows 7 및 Windows Server 2008에서도 작동한다고 말씀드릴 수 있습니다.

관련 정보